Key takeaway

As a non-asset-based, third-party logistics provider, Expeditors purchases cargo space from carriers and resells it, without owning aircraft or ships.

Beneath the surface

Operating cash flow of $1.007 billion exceeded net income of $810 million, but financing activities used $802 million, suggesting heavy capital return (dividends/buybacks) versus reinvestment, though specific buyback figures aren't broken out in the provided facts.
